The Palas were patrons of Mahayana Buddhism. A few sources written much after Gopala's death mention him as a Buddhist, but it is not known if this is true. The subsequent Pala kings were definitely Buddhists. Taranatha states that Gopala was a staunch Buddhist, who had built the famous monastery at Odantapuri. The artworks are in the shape of a vast number of palm-leaf manuscripts depicting Buddhist themes. The manuscript of the Astasahasrika-Prajnaparamita (The Perfection of Wisdom in Eight Thousand) is the best example.

Small, skillfully crafted portraits created on vellum, prepared card, copper, or ivory are known as miniature paintings, also known as limning (16th–17th century). The term comes from the red lead known as minium that mediaeval illuminaters used. WebPala art was defined by subdued colours and sinuous lines, evocative of the murals in Ajanta. While it was Buddhism in the east, it was Jainism that inspired the miniature artistic movement of the Western Indian style of miniature painting.
